as for changing your appearance, some modules use SetAppearance(), which (as Gothmog mentioned) you can also access from the command console; this just gives a purely cosmetic change to your PC's appearance - here's a list of the default range of possible appearances: http://www.nwnwiki.org/Appearance.2da

other modules also utilise the character subrace field to implement appearance changes, enabling not only the appearance change to be hard coded into the module, but also allowing special racial abilities to be handled as well - possible examples would include vampiric abilities, lycanthropy, mind flayers and others
